I picked it up at a new bottle shop for me, cloverleaf, and was excited to try it out considering how I enjoy other Unibroue beverages. This was a bit different, lighter, than all of the other beers I have had from them. It was very refreshing :) Pours a nice transparent light yellow with a tight white head. Aroma is light and fruity, like granny smith apples. Taste is very similar, light, very very carbonated (which adds nicely to the mouthfeel, as BeerBaron617 pointed out), and is a lot like having a sparkling apple cider. | 3.5 | Aroma | Appearance | Flavor | Palate | Overall | | 7/10 | 4/5 | 7/10 | 3/5 | 14/20 | Jun 27, 2009 12 oz bottle: This brew has a really nice aroma for a Wit somewhat dry, lemon, yeast, fruity, sweet, and has some decent spice notes. Appearance is a clear golden with a hint of amber mixed in there and a fluffy white head. Taste is definitely a Wit lightly subtle wheat notes, dry, yeast, bubbly on the tongue, fruity, and a nice light spice characteristic. Palate is bubbly on the tongue with a linger yeast and wheat characteristic in the aftertaste. Overall, It’s a really nice light wit that I will enjoy on this nice summer day. Cheers!
